The American Cancer Society has awarded a $792,000 multi-year research grant to John Ebos, PhD, of the Department of Pharmacology and Therapeutics at Roswell Park.
Patients with metastatic kidney cancer often stop treatment when the tumor becomes resistant to the drugs they are receiving. In many cases, the tumor can immediately begin to grow again. Dr. Ebos is studying a vaccine to inhibit the tumor growth that often happens when treatment has stopped, providing much-needed time to identify new treatment options for the patient.
